    THERA G 2 B MONITOR INSTALLING THE MONITOR IN A SUP-GB2 SURFACE BOX Avoid placing the monitor near sources of heat, in dusty locations or smoky environments. Positioning the SUP-GB2 surface box: The upper part of the SUP-GB2 surface box must be positioned at a height of 1.60 m. The minimum distance between the sides of the surface box and the closest object must be 5 cm.

    THERA G 2 B MONITOR INSTALLING THE MONITOR IN A UNIVERSAL EMBEDDING BOX Avoid placing the monitor near sources of heat, in dusty locations or smoky environments. Positioning the embedding box: Make a hole in the wall to position the top of the universal embedding box at a height of 1.60 m from the ground. The minimum distance between the embedding box and the closest object must be 5 cm.

The call is unanswered (resident unavailable) When a call is received, the monitor(s) will play a melody (the status light of the monitor(s) will blink) and show the image of the door panel on the main monitor without alerting the visitor. If the call is not answered in 40 seconds the monitor returns to standby.

    THERA G 2 B MONITOR USER MENU Continued from the previous page. Function codes (installer): [8000]: Master m onitor ( factory [8001] [8003]: Slave monitor [8004]: Surveillance onitor. [8005]: Without surveillance monitor factory [9015]: Intercom enabled actory [9016]: Intercom disabled Each apartment must have only one master unit: Any further units in the apartment must be con gured as slaves.
